Contents:
Part One: A new awakening. Learning a new way ; How the culture sets up parents to fail ; The invisible triggers of our reactivity -- Part Two: Our parenting myths. Myth #1: Parenting is about the child ; Myth #2: A successful child is ahead of the curve ; Myth #3: There are good children and bad children ; Myth #4: Good parents are naturals ; Myth #5: A good parent is a loving one ; Myth #6: Parenting is about raising a happy child ; Myth #7: Parents need to be in control -- Part Three: Understanding our reactivity. Raising the real child ; What's really behind our reactions ; Transforming fear into consciousness -- Part Four: Transformative parenting skills. From expectations to engagement ; From mindless reaction to mindful presence ; From chaos to stillness ; From role to no-role ; From emotions to feelings ; From enmeshment to autonomy ; From judgment to empathy ; From discipline to enlightened boundaries ; From the battlefield to the negotiation table -- Epilogue: Shedding skin, shedding light -- Appendix: Thirty daily reminders to build consciousness.
Summary: "New from the New York Times bestselling author of The Conscious Parent comes a radically transformative plan that shows parents how to raise children to be their best, truest selves, "--Amazon.com.
